Nearly all drugs pass into human breast milk. How often a drug is taken influences the amount of drug that will pass into the milk. Medications taken 30 to 60 minutes before breastfeeding are likely to be at peak blood levels when the baby is nursing.

Chronic necrotizing aspergillosis has a slowly progressive process that, unlike invasive aspergillosis, does not spread to other organ systems or the blood vessels. It most often affects middle-aged and elderly individuals, spreading to surrounding tissue in the lungs. The disease often does not respond to conventionally successful treatments, and requires individualized therapies in order to keep it from becoming life-threatening.

Your skin wrinkles if you stay in the bathtub a long time because the outermost layer of skin (which consists of dead keratin) swells when it absorbs water. It is tightly attached to the skin below it, so it compensates for the increased area by wrinkling. This happens to the hands and feet because they have the thickest layer of dead keratin cells.

Interferon was scarce and expensive until 1980, when the interferon gene was inserted into bacteria using recombinant DNA technology, allowing for mass cultivation and purification from bacterial cultures.
